Ready? For this first DIY, you will need the following:

  • 10 tbs of Baraka Shea Butter
  • 10 tbs of safflower oil
  • 3-4 drops of Lavender essential oil
  • A hand immersion mixer

Step 1: Combine Shea Butter and Safflower oil in a glass bowl.

Step 2: Add 3-4 drops of lavender essential oils (or an oil of your choice).

Step 3: Mix with a hand-immersion mixer until smooth.

Step 4: Pour into container …  and there you go!

I love this mixture because the lavender is calming (especially for someone like me with MAJOR anxiety) and the aroma helps me sleep at night. Whip that baby up until it is a creamy lotion-y substance and use it after you shower for incredibly supple skin.

Ready for another (um, yes please)? This one is great if you do not have a hand-immersion mixer on hand.

For this second DIY, you will need the following:

  • ½ cup of Baraka Shea Butter
  • ½ cup of Jojoba
  • ¼ cup of Coconut Oil
  • A working stove or hot plate

Step 1: Pour all three ingredients into a heat-safe glass bowl and mix together.

Step 2: Place the glass bowl in a saucepan filled with water.

Step 3: Heat the stove and continue mixing.

Step 4: Once they have combined, place in the fridge for an hour or so.

Step 5: Pull out of the fridge (okay this portion technically longer than 10 minutes) and mix together.

Step 6: Place in container, store, and enjoy!

I love this one because there is less of a scent and can be perfect for anyone who prefers unscented lotions.
